Man Survives 400-Meter Fall

Photobucket
Who: A 27-year-old climber
Where: On the Hirschkarlgrat in Obersteirmark, Austria
His mistake: Choosing a short route down a steep snow gully
What happened: The 27-year-old-climber and a partner were descending from the Hirscchkarlgrat towards the Grieskogel and decided to take a shorter route down a snow covered ravine. When they were 400 meters down the ravine, they ran into frozen snow causing the climber to slip and fall 150 meters down the ravine. When his partner reached him he was unable to get a cell phone signal to call for help and had to climb down until he ran into a hunter who drove him for help. A rescue helicopter recovered the fallen climber from the ravine and he was pronounced dead by air rescue doctor.
